你查询的IP:[118.89.189.109]  地理位置:中国–上海–上海

最新查询117.58.129.135 221.176.209.61 203.92.106.180 124.224.125.71 117.24.106.137 58.128.121.137 221.247.143.75 119.48.129.224 117.57.181.230 118.89.189.109 116.199.78.161 202.124.24.35 120.30.88.58 121.51.174.10 125.254.128.252 122.204.132.145 202.127.160.138 59.80.204.102 221.198.153.32 202.90.224.160 124.112.111.92 210.23.32.130 121.79.128.153 222.16.67.15 119.164.169.62 221.176.139.180 203.130.32.29 116.69.27.179 203.135.96.5 211.64.149.116 122.136.197.156